    @zstation64 6 лет назад

    GM Opticlene washer fluid is the stuff you want. In winter use it neat and you're good to -30C. I dilute it 4:1 and it's still good enough to deice my windscreen at -4C. Not cheap, about £30 for 5 litres from your local Vauxhall garage, but 5 litres does me a year as you need very little of it. Far better than the premix crap from Halfords and the likes. Also diluted way down like 10:1 in summer it is great for taking bugs off.

    • @Reef_UK
      @Reef_UK 6 лет назад +3

      Hey luke, I think you're getting a little mixed up with the gear selector functions, if you pull up or push down the right hand stalk it will change up/down a gear and hold it in manual mode for a short while (you'll see little triangles next to the gear display on the dash) but if you push the little inch long collar near the end of the stalk (not talking about the retarder button on the end of the stalk btw) inwards toward the steering wheel it will select between manual/auto mode until you press the collar in again, thus giving you continued manual mode for as long as you require it, you then obviously change up and down gears using the stalk as you'd expect.

    • @sideshowblob
      @sideshowblob 4 года назад

      In those countries, low temps and lots of snow is a yearly occorunce and lasts a while. Those countries and their people have adapted and invested in driving and working in such conditions. Everyone is used to it. In the UK and Ireland, this sort of thing happens once every four or five years and only lasts a few days. The infrastructure isn't there (snow ploughs, gritters etc) because there's no point spending tonnes of money on something that rarely happens. It also means barely anyone knows how to drive in these conditions.
